NUcore at 10: A Decade of Experience Developing a Core Facilities Management Application
Jeffrey Weiss1, Philip Hockberger1, Todd Shamaly1
1Feinberg School of Medicine, Northwestern University, Chicago, Illinois 60611, USA.
Journal of Biomolecular Techniques : JBT
|July 15, 2022
Summary
Northwestern University developed NUcore, an open-source software solution for managing core facilities. This custom platform offers seamless integration and reporting, successfully supporting half of the university's sponsored award dollars.
Area of Science:
- Biotechnology
- Research Administration
- Software Engineering
Background:
- Managing a portfolio of core facilities requires effective software solutions.
- Commercial software is available, but custom platforms offer institutions greater control and integration capabilities.
Purpose of the Study:
- To describe the development, implementation, and decade-long results of a custom software platform, NUcore, at Northwestern University.
- To highlight NUcore's features, benefits, and impact on core facility management.
Main Methods:
- Reorganization of the core facilities program starting in 2008.
- Development and adoption of a custom software platform, NUcore, with a focus on integration and user experience.
- Management of NUcore as an open-source project since its full enrollment in 2019.
Main Results:
- NUcore, implemented in 2011 and fully enrolled by 2019, provides a stable, secure, and intuitive interface.
- The platform seamlessly integrates with the university financial system, ensuring compliance and offering robust reporting.
- NUcore supports nearly 50% of sponsored award dollars at NU, with a transaction cost of $0.01 per dollar, serving over 4000 active users annually.
Conclusions:
- NUcore has been a substantial success for Northwestern University, demonstrating the viability of custom, open-source software for core facility management.
- The open-source nature of NUcore allows for cost-free adoption by other academic organizations, with five currently utilizing the codebase.
- Continuous development of NUcore ensures its future adaptability to evolving university and core facility needs.

Nuclear Power
8.2K
Controlled nuclear fission reactions are used to generate electricity. Any nuclear reactor that produces power via the fission of uranium or plutonium by bombardment with neutrons has six components: nuclear fuel consisting of fissionable material, a nuclear moderator, a neutron source, control rods, reactor coolant, and a shield and containment system.

Midrange
3.8K
A somewhat easy to compute quantitative estimate of a data set’s central tendency is its midrange, which is defined as the mean of the minimum and maximum values of an ordered data set.
Simply put, the midrange is half of the data set’s range. Similar to the mean, the midrange is sensitive to the extreme values and hence the prospective outliers. Control Systems
1.4K
Control systems are everywhere in contemporary society, influencing diverse applications from aerospace to automated manufacturing. These systems can be found naturally within biological processes, such as blood sugar regulation and heart rate adjustment in response to stress, as well as in man-made systems like elevators and automated vehicles. A control system is essentially a network of subsystems and processes that collaboratively convert specific inputs into desired outputs.
